Chapter 6
Forged Connections
Isolated by her dangerous quest, Mara cautiously forms alliances with others affected by memory erasure. Trust is a fragile commodity in this world.
The hum of the archive was a familiar lullaby, a constant thrum beneath the surface of Mara’s consciousness. But lately, the sound felt less like comfort and more like a shroud. Each meticulously cataloged fragment of someone else’s past, each digital ghost of joy or sorrow, whispered of the void. Her isolation was a heavy cloak, woven from the secrets she carried and the fear that coiled in her gut. Who could she speak to? Who would believe her? The memory market was a necessary evil, a balm for the wounded, but the idea of actively *stealing* and erasing was a perversion of its very purpose.
She’d spent the last few days sifting through the illicit cache, the one she’d stumbled upon in the forgotten sub-basement. The sheer volume was staggering, but it was the *specificity* that chilled her. Not random fragments of pain, but precise moments of profound grief, sharp pangs of betrayal, the gut-wrenching finality of loss. And then, the unsettling realization that these weren't just isolated incidents. There was a pattern, a deliberate excision. Her own memory, the phantom limb of a life she couldn’t recall, pulsed with a silent question.
Mara knew she couldn't go it alone. The weight of the conspiracy was too immense, the forces arrayed against her too powerful. But trust was a currency rarer than pristine memories in this city. Every interaction was a delicate dance, a constant assessment of hidden motives. She began by reaching out, tentatively, to those who had shown a flicker of unease, a subtle dissatisfaction with the prevailing order.
